KANSAS CITY, Mo. (KCTV) – We have more rain in the picture this week, but thankfully, we are not looking at a repeat of Tuesday’s severe storms and intense rainfall.

This will be patchy on Thursday, but we are First Warning that it will be more widespread on Friday.

We also have reduced air quality due to smoke all the way from Canadian wildfires. This should improve some by Thursday.

TONIGHT: Dry with evening temperatures in the 70s and 60s. Light northeast winds.

THURSDAY: Dry with upper 50s to start, but watch for patchy rain around lunch. The wet hours look to be 11 am to 1 pm, with the rest of the afternoon looking dry. Highs will hit the mid-70s, and winds will be light from the northeast at 5-10 mph.
